Description

Advances in AI and technology have already significantly impacted our lives and raise harrowing ethical and societal questions about our future. Some issues to be considered in the course are: the appropriate use of AI in academic settings; how we ought to integrate these new technologies into our lives; and whether we have any moral obligations to AI itself, even if it is not consciously aware. Students will discover various positions that can be taken on these and other issues by utilizing ethical theories and develop arguments to support their own positions. Prerequisite: None. Offered: Fall, Spring.
